Unhappy Beware!

So I got the EAS kit, and I got the trunk, and the door ones taken care of and then started the hardest part, which was the dome lights in the overhead console - Got the part out and all that, and even though the car was switched off, ended up shorting something while changing the bulbs leading to a 4 digit repair cost and a replacement head unit being shipped from Germany. Safe to say having learned the hard way, paid $300 including labor and got BMW to replace them all with the OEM LED kit. Now i'm stuck with an EAS kit that I need to get rid off! Keep in mind, i've changed LED interiors on BMWs and other cars successfully before, I just think the M5 is a little different. In hindsight, maybe disconnect the battery...
